What Are Diet Medications?
Diet medications, also called anti-obesity medications, are prescription drugs intended at assisting people in reducing weight by suppressing appetite, increasing feelings of fullness, or blocking fat absorption. They are generally suggested for individuals with a body mass index (BMI) higher than 30 or those with a BMI over 27 who likewise have weight-related health conditions.

Absorption inhibitors prevent the body from absorbing a portion of the fat from the food consumed, successfully reducing calorie intake. They may be helpful for individuals who have a hard time to manage their fat usage through dietary modifications alone.

FAQs About Diet Medications1. Are diet medications reliable for everybody?
Answer: No, diet medications are ineffective for everybody. Their effectiveness can differ depending on individual biology, adherence to a treatment strategy, and lifestyle modifications.
2. Can diet medications be used long-term?
Answer: Some diet medications are created for short-term use, while others may be proper for long-term management. Long-lasting usage ought to always be kept an eye on by a doctor.
3. Do diet medications work without diet and exercise?
Response: While diet medications can aid weight-loss, they are most efficient when combined with dietary modifications and routine workout.
